Here are some tips that can help you save energy, mainly by making your kitchen more green.

A lot of electricity is definitely wasted when fridges and freezers, both heavy users of electricity anyway, are not operating efficiently. You can certainly save up to 60% on energy once you get a new one, in comparison to those from longer than ten years ago. The appropriate temperature for food is 37F within the fridge and 0F in the freezer, and sticking to these will use a lesser amount of electricity. One more way to save electricity is to keep the condenser clean, for the reason that the motor won’t have to go as often.

The ingredients needed to cook Smoked Rump Roast Chili:

  1. Take of Chili.
  2. Take 3 lbs of Round Rump Roast.
  3. Take 1 can of kidney beans.
  4. Get 1 can of red beans.
  5. Get 1 can of pinto beans.
  6. Provide 1 of sweet onion.
  7. Take 6 cloves of garlic.
  8. Take 1/2 of habanero pepper.
  9. Take 1 of green jalapeño.
  10. Use 1 of red jalapeño.
  11. You need 1 of Thai chili.
  12. Provide 1 of Serrano chili.
  13. Use 1 of lemon drop chili.
  14. Get 1 can of fire roasted crushed tomatoes (28 oz.).
  15. Prepare 1 can of fire roasted diced tomatoes (14.5 oz.).
  16. Get of Chili seasoning.
  17. You need 3 tbsp of chili powder.
  18. Prepare 2 tbsp of Mom’s Bean Spice.
  19. Provide 1 tbsp of cumin.
  20. Prepare 1 tbsp of smoked paprika.
  21. Prepare 1 tsp of course sea salt (modify to taste).
  22. Prepare of Meat rub.
  23. Prepare 3 tbsp of chili powder.
  24. You need 1 tbsp of cumin.
  25. Get 1/2 tbsp of smoked paprika.
  26. You need 1 tbsp of course sea salt.
  27. Use 1/2 tbsp of course black pepper.
  28. Take 1/2 tbsp of granulated onion.
  29. Use 1 tbsp of granulated galic.

Instructions to make Smoked Rump Roast Chili:

  1. Cut rump roast into 3/4”-1” squares..
  2. Combine meat rub ingredients and mix thoroughly..
  3. In 1 gallon zip-loc bag, add meat, rub & a splash of olive oil. Shake to coat meat. Place bag of meat in refrigerator for a minimum of 4hrs. Can be left in refrigerator overnight..
  4. Dice or chop onion & peppers (size to preference). Crush garlic in garlic press..
  5. Combine onion, garlic, chili seasoning & remaining chili ingredients into large crock pot (7 qt+) and turn on high..
  6. Set smoker for 200 degrees..
  7. While crock pot and smoker are heating, take coated meat and skewer..
  8. Place skewers on smoker for 1.5-2 hrs. Meat can be 125-140 degrees..
  9. Add meat to crockpot and stir. Replace lid and leave on high for 6 hrs..
  10. After 6 hrs set crockpot to low/warm & serve..
